Understanding narcissistic manipulation

Narcissistic manipulation is a form of psychological abuse that aims to control and manipulate others for personal gain. Understanding how narcissistic manipulation works is the first step in protecting your mental health. Narcissists often exhibit grandiose behavior, a sense of entitlement, and a lack of empathy for others. They manipulate others through various tactics such as gaslighting, projecting their own faults onto others, and manipulating emotions to gain control. By understanding the mechanisms behind narcissistic manipulation, you can start to recognize when it's happening to you and take steps to protect yourself.

Recognizing the signs of narcissistic manipulation can be challenging, as narcissists are often skilled at masking their true intentions. However, there are certain red flags to look out for. These may include constantly feeling belittled or criticized, feeling like you're walking on eggshells around the person, or experiencing extreme mood swings due to their manipulative tactics. Trusting your gut instincts and paying attention to any feelings of unease or discomfort in your interactions with others is important. By being aware of these signs, you can start to take action to protect your mental health.

The impact of narcissistic manipulation on mental health

The impact of narcissistic manipulation on mental health cannot be underestimated. Constant exposure to manipulative behavior can lead to a range of psychological issues, including anxiety, depression, low self-esteem, and even post-traumatic stress disorder (PTSD). The gaslighting and emotional manipulation employed by narcissists can erode your sense of self-worth and make you question your own reality. Over time, this can result in a loss of confidence, isolation, and a diminished ability to trust others.

It's essential to recognize the toll that narcissistic manipulation can take on your mental health and take steps to protect yourself. Ignoring the impact or trying to rationalize the behavior of a narcissist will only prolong your suffering. By facing the reality of the situation and actively seeking ways to reclaim your power, you can begin the healing process and rebuild your mental well-being.

Signs of narcissistic manipulation

To effectively protect your mental health from narcissistic manipulation, it's crucial to be able to identify the signs and patterns of this behavior. Here are some common signs to watch out for:

  1. Lack of empathy: Narcissists often struggle to understand or care about the feelings and needs of others. They may dismiss your emotions or trivialize your experiences, leaving you feeling invalidated and unheard.
  2. Constant need for validation: Narcissists crave attention and validation from others. They may constantly seek praise, admiration, or reassurance, often at the expense of others' well-being.
  3. Manipulative tactics: Gaslighting, projecting their own faults onto others, blame-shifting, and guilt-tripping are common tactics used by narcissists to manipulate and control those around them.
  4. Boundary violations: Narcissists often have little respect for boundaries. They may invade your personal space, disregard your privacy, or push your limits to maintain control over you.
  5. Love-bombing followed by devaluation: In the early stages of a relationship, narcissists may shower you with love, attention, and gifts. However, they may devalue and discard you over time once they have gained control.

By being able to recognize these signs, you can begin to protect yourself from narcissistic manipulation. Trust your instincts and pay attention to any feelings of discomfort or unease in your interactions with others.

Strategies for Reclaiming Your Power

Reclaiming your power from narcissistic manipulation is a journey that requires strength, resilience, and self-reflection. Here are some strategies to help you regain control over your mental well-being:

1. Setting boundaries with narcissistic individuals

Establishing clear boundaries is crucial when dealing with narcissistic individuals. Communicate your needs and expectations assertively, and be prepared to enforce consequences if your boundaries are violated. Remember that you have the right to protect your mental health and well-being, even if it means distancing yourself from toxic people.

2. Building a support network

Surrounding yourself with a supportive network of friends, family, or therapists can provide the validation and emotional support you need to heal from narcissistic manipulation. Seek out those who understand and validate your experiences, and lean on them when you need support.

3. Practicing self-care and self-compassion

Narcissistic manipulation can leave you feeling depleted and emotionally drained. Prioritize self-care activities that nourish your mind, body, and soul. Engage in activities that bring you joy, practice mindfulness and self-compassion, and prioritize your own needs and well-being.

4. Seeking professional help and therapy

Working with a therapist who specializes in trauma and narcissistic abuse can be immensely helpful in your healing journey. A professional can provide guidance, validation, and specific strategies to help you overcome the effects of narcissistic manipulation and reclaim your power.

5. Educating yourself about narcissistic personality disorder

Knowledge is power when it comes to protecting your mental health from narcissistic manipulation. Educate yourself about the characteristics of narcissistic personality disorder, the tactics they employ, and the impact it can have on your mental well-being. This knowledge will help you validate your experiences and empower you to take the necessary steps to protect yourself.
